After Willow Hall moves into New York City, the twenty-year-old finds that life is much bigger than what was in her small town of Cape May. With new beginnings and anxieties, she slowly finds her way into adulthood and individuality.
Quinn Diaz, on the other hand, has always lived in NYC and knows the 'tricks of the trade'. He has had a troubled past, sharing some qualities with the yet-to-know Willow, and now spends his time managing the 'No Time to Dine' Café.
Despite petty arguments, when the two are forced to work together in an unlikely situation, the two hit it off and begin to understand the importance of finding another in such a big city.
A new job, new friends, a love interest, and painfully shocking twists that only make their lives just a little more interesting; twisted hopes turn into twisted beginnings as the dramatic events of Willow and Quinn's new beginning together unfold.
